Question Using Empty Categories, Description Not Showing

Hello, in order to enable our static pages to be part of the main product navigation, we decided to use the category pages and descriptions instead. Since they essentially have the WYSIWYG editor and similar functionality.

The problem is that we don't need to add products to these categories, but when we remove the products, the description disappears.

We are using the latest version 4.2.2 and an example page is here:
https://juhlir.tempdomainname.com/store/home.php?cat=274

Any help with what file controls the descriptions and what code to use in order to allow the descriptions to display when no products are present?

This is not a problem for me. I just tested it out on a stock versino of x-cart 4.2.1 and it works fine. It;s somehthing in your install.

The file that controls this is subcategories.tpl

Are you using a custom skin or have done extensive alterations to the skin?
